Shared embedding layer
Webb20 juni 2024 · I want my output layer to be the same, but transposed (from H to V). Something like this (red connections denote shared weights): I implemented it via a shared layers. My input is a shared Embedding layer. And I defined a TiedEmbeddingsTransposed layer, which transposes the embedding matrix from a given layer (and applies an … WebbEnjoy the videos and music you love, upload original content, and share it all with friends, family, and the world on YouTube.
Shared embedding layer
Did you know?
WebbYour embedding matrix may be too large to fit on your GPU. In this case you will see an Out Of Memory (OOM) error. In such cases, you should place the embedding matrix on the CPU memory. You can do so with a device scope, as such: with tf.device('cpu:0'): … WebbShared layers Another good use for the functional API are models that use shared layers. Let's take a look at shared layers. Let's consider a dataset of tweets. We want to build a model that can tell whether two tweets are from the same person or not (this can allow us to compare users by the similarity of their tweets, for instance).
Webb6 feb. 2024 · By using the functional API you can easily share weights between different parts of your network. In your case we have an Input x which is our input, then we will have a Dense layer called shared. Then we will have three different Dense layers called sub1, sub2 and sub3 and then three output layers called out1, out2 and out3. Webb25 maj 2024 · 先来看看什么是embedding,我们可以简单的理解为,将一个特征转换为一个向量。. 在推荐系统当中,我们经常会遇到离散特征,如userid、itemid。. 对于离散特征,我们一般的做法是将其转换为one-hot,但对于itemid这种离散特征,转换成one-hot之后维度非常高,但里面 ...
Webb4 nov. 2024 · Each layer is comprised of a combination of multi-head attention blocks, positional feedforward layers, normalization, and residual connections. The attention layers from the encoder and decoder are slightly different: the encoder only has self … Webb27 juli 2024 · Shared layers. Defining two inputs. Lookup both inputs in the same model. Merge layers. Output layer using shared layer. Model using two inputs and one output. Predict from your model. Fit the model to the regular season training data. Evaluate the …
Webb1 mars 2024 · Shared layers are layer instances that are reused multiple times in the same model -- they learn features that correspond to multiple paths in the graph-of-layers. Shared layers are often used to encode inputs from similar spaces (say, two different pieces of …
Webband embedding layer. Based on How does Keras 'Embedding' layer work? the embedding layer first initialize the embedding vector at random and then uses network optimizer to update it similarly like it would do to any other network layer in keras. dfly i5-8265u/t13fsv/8/s256/w10p/l/4cWebb2. share embedding实现多目标学习 2.1 基本思路. 思路:让所有目标共享embedding层,每个目标单独用一个塔建模。 优点:一般情况下embedding层参数量最大,重要性最强,共享参数使得即使是稀疏的任务也可以使用拟合效果很好的特征向量,且节省大量资源。 dfly groupWebbCustom Layers and Utilities Join the Hugging Face community and get access to the augmented documentation experience Collaborate on models, datasets and Spaces Faster examples with accelerated inference Switch between documentation themes to get started Custom Layers and Utilities d-fly di2 ew-wu101 itaWebb3 okt. 2024 · The Embedding layer has weights that are learned. If you save your model to file, this will include weights for the Embedding layer. The output of the Embedding layer is a 2D vector with one embedding for each word in the input sequence of words (input document).. If you wish to connect a Dense layer directly to an Embedding layer, you … churn-staffWebb30 juni 2024 · Quantum Research Scientist. May 2024 - Present2 years. Yorktown Heights, New York, United States. Focus on engineering level challenges in quantum devices and quantum information science to ... churn southside pittsburghWebb10 dec. 2024 · You can also learn a single embedding vector by using a shared embedding parameter layer in your model while training (Siamese network with shared parameters [25]). So why create two separate vectors for each object? Let’s inspect technical and logical reasoning. churn statusWebbFor a newly constructed Embedding, the embedding vector at padding_idx will default to all zeros, but can be updated to another value to be used as the padding vector. max_norm (float, optional) – If given, each embedding vector with norm larger than max_norm is … dfly i5-8265u/t13f/8/s256/w10p/4c